CSSの履歴

CSSを書く上で、以下に無駄を省けるか、っていうのはとても大事だと思う。

やっぱりデザインと言っても、できるだけシンプルに「ルール決め」をした方が管理はしやすいし、そういうCSSコーディングを意識して行うことで自分のアビリティは伸びると思う。

例①

* {
margin:0;
padding:0;
border:0;
}


と一度初期化しているにもかかわらず、ついつい

table {
width:450px; 
margin:25px auto 0 auto;
border:0;


なんて書いてしまったりする。特にテーブルなんかだと。
これって1行無駄にしているし、その分ソースが長くなってみづらくもなったりする。

.hoge {
margin:0 auto 0 auto;
}

.hoge {
margin:0 auto;
}


たまに前者みたいにやってしまったりする。
まじ無駄。
こういうのも後者のようにしないとね~。